As promised, I am reposting the info for the upcoming presentations of
a stage version of Roberta Gregory's "Bitchy Bitch" (as seen in the
_Naughty_Bits_ comic from Fantagraphics). 

"Bitchy Bitch" will be presented four times during the Seattle Fringe
Festival in March:

	March 9  (Thursday)	10:00
	March 12 (Sunday)	10:00
	March 13 (Monday)	 8:00
	March 18 (Saturday)	 5:30

The play will be presented at the New City Theatre (1632 11th Avenue), in
Seattle, Washington.  Tickets are available at the Broadway Market (410
Broadway Avenue E, corner of Republican) for $8, or by phone at
(206) 325-5446 for $10.

Last thing I knew, Maggie Bloodstone was playing the lead and both Roberta
Gregory and Donna Barr were cast in small roles; Barr is supposed to be
designing the costumes, too.
